ARTIST: Steve Ferguson (American, born 1946)
NAME: B-1B Lancer
YEAR: 1992
MEDIUM: acrylic on board
CONDITION: Excellent.
SIGHT SIZE: 16 x 14 inches / 40 x 35 cm
BOARD SIZE: 20 x 15 inches / 50 x 38 cm
SIGNATURE: lower left
NOTE: This painting was originally published on the Republic of the Marshall Islands 33c B-1B Lancer stamp issued June 1, 1999. Two-thirds the size of a B-52 Stratofortress, the Rockwell International B-1B Lancer incorporates stealth technology that allows for a radar signature one one-hundredth of the former's. In addition, the Lancer can carry almost twice the armaments of the B-52 -- 24 one-ton nuclear bombs or 22 air-launched cruise missiles.

BIOGRAPHY:
Steve is known best for creating vibrant and passionate pieces of art. He started his training at the age of 34 and had his first exhibition in Sussex a year later. He channels his inspiration from nature, texture and form with the inspiration of many great artists past and present and particularly from the Cornish artists and sculptors.For the past nine years he has been selling his work at Greenwich Art and Craft market in London.In the past two year his work has been displayed successfully in galleries in Sussex and further a field.Galleries in which Steven's work can be viewed are Io Gallery in Brighton ,The Wood Store in Brighton Green tree Gallery at Borde hill gardens in West Sussex , Gallery fifty five in Hampshire,Fisherton mill Gallery in Sailsbury,Saltbox Gallery in York and Doghouse Gallery in Belfast.
